Dental veneers are an increasingly popular option for individuals seeking to enhance their smiles and restore dental aesthetics. Mexico, known for its affordable and high-quality dental care, has become a sought-after destination for dental veneers through dental tourism. In this comprehensive guide, we will examine the pros and cons of getting dental veneers in Mexico, providing industry professionals and their clients with valuable insights to consider before making a decision.
The Pros of Getting Dental Veneers in Mexico
- Cost Savings: One of the primary advantages of getting dental veneers in Mexico is the significant cost savings compared to many other countries. Mexico offers competitive pricing without compromising on quality, allowing patients to achieve their desired smile makeover at a fraction of the cost.
- High-Quality Dental Care: Mexico has a reputation for providing high-quality dental care. Many dental clinics in Mexico utilize state-of-the-art technology and employ skilled dental professionals who are experienced in cosmetic dentistry, including dental veneers. Patients can expect exceptional results and long-lasting aesthetics.
- Expedited Treatment: Dental clinics in Mexico often have shorter waiting times compared to other countries. This means that patients can receive their dental veneers in a timely manner, minimizing the time spent waiting for appointments and procedures.
- Travel Opportunities: Getting dental veneers in Mexico provides an opportunity for patients to combine their dental treatment with a vacation. Mexico's rich culture, beautiful beaches, and historical landmarks offer a range of exciting activities to enjoy before or after dental procedures.
- Certified Dental Professionals: By collaborating with dental clinics that employ certified dental professionals, patients can have confidence in the expertise and skills of the dental team. Certified dental travel professionals who have completed the Certified Medical Travel Professional program can guide patients in selecting reputable dental clinics in Mexico.
- Wide Range of Treatment Options: Dental clinics in Mexico offer a wide range of treatment options when it comes to dental veneers. Patients can choose from various materials, such as porcelain or composite resin, and work closely with dental professionals to achieve the desired shape, color, and overall aesthetic outcome.
- Experienced Cosmetic Dentists: Mexico is known for its experienced cosmetic dentists who specialize in dental veneers. These professionals have honed their skills through extensive training and hands-on experience, ensuring that patients receive expert care and achieve the desired results.
- Convenience and Efficiency: Dental clinics in Mexico often provide comprehensive treatment plans, including all necessary procedures for dental veneers. This convenience and efficiency allow patients to undergo the entire process in one location, saving time and streamlining the treatment experience.
- Improved Self-Confidence: Dental veneers can have a significant impact on a person's self-confidence and self-esteem. By enhancing the appearance of their smile, patients can experience a boost in self-confidence and a positive transformation in various aspects of their lives.
The Cons of Getting Dental Veneers in Mexico
- Language Barriers: Communication may pose a challenge for some patients, particularly if they do not speak Spanish. While many dental professionals in Mexico speak English, it is essential to clarify the language proficiency of the dental team beforehand to ensure effective communication throughout the treatment process.
- Travel Logistics: Traveling to Mexico for dental veneers requires careful planning and consideration of travel logistics. Patients need to arrange flights, accommodations, and transportation, which can add complexity to the overall process. However, working with certified dental travel professionals can alleviate some of these logistical burdens.
- Limited Follow-Up Care: Patients who choose to get dental veneers in Mexico may face challenges in receiving follow-up care if complications or adjustments are necessary after returning to their home country. It is crucial to discuss post-treatment care options with the dental clinic and determine the best course of action for any necessary follow-up care.
- Long-Distance Consultations: Initial consultations and treatment planning may need to be conducted remotely, which can limit in-person evaluations and discussions. However, with advancements in telemedicine and communication technology, virtual consultations can be effective in assessing patient needs and developing personalized treatment plans.
- Potential Culture and Legal Differences: Patients should familiarize themselves with the cultural norms and legal considerations in Mexico to ensure a smooth and respectful experience. It is essential to understand the local dental regulations and patient rights to feel confident and comfortable throughout the dental veneer process.
- Longer Treatment Duration: While dental clinics in Mexico strive to provide efficient treatment, patients must consider that getting dental veneers in another country may require multiple visits. The process may take longer due to travel arrangements and the need for sufficient time for consultations, preparation, fabrication, and placement of the veneers.
- Limited Warranty and Follow-Up Care: Dental clinics in Mexico may have different warranty policies and follow-up care options compared to those in a patient's home country. Patients should inquire about the specific terms and conditions regarding warranty and aftercare to ensure they understand the level of support provided by the dental clinic.
- Adjustment to Local Standards: Dental standards and practices may vary from one country to another. Patients considering dental veneers in Mexico should familiarize themselves with the local standards and regulations to ensure that the dental clinic adheres to proper infection control, sterilization procedures, and safety protocols.
- Possible Cultural and Communication Differences: Patients from different cultural backgrounds may experience variations in communication styles, approaches to healthcare, and treatment expectations. It is important to have open and clear communication with the dental team in Mexico to ensure mutual understanding and a satisfactory treatment experience.
- Travel-Related Discomfort: Traveling to another country for dental treatment can be physically and emotionally demanding for some individuals. Long flights, jet lag, and adjusting to a new environment may add a level of discomfort or stress to the overall experience. It is essential for patients to consider their personal preferences and physical well-being before embarking on dental veneers in Mexico.
